Beijing 700R Inherits Sleek Design, Annoying Alphanumericism Of Western Sports Cars

Another day, another set of pics of a could-be Chinese supercar. As with the Soueast X1 and other concepts, this car doesn't appear to have a motor or, likely, even an interior. Still, it is nice to see BAW, which produces the Hummer Jeep, come up with their own concept. Though it borrows a little here and there from… »4/28/08 11:20am4/28/08 11:20am